Importance of Foundation Stability in Power Plants

Structural Evaluation

Foundation stability is a critical aspect of any power plant’s structural integrity. The foundation serves as the bedrock upon which all other components are built, and any compromise in its stability can lead to catastrophic failures. In power plants, where heavy machinery and equipment are installed, the loads exerted on the foundation are substantial.

Therefore, it is essential that these foundations are designed and maintained to withstand not only static loads but also dynamic forces that may arise from operational activities or environmental conditions. Moreover, the implications of foundation instability extend beyond immediate structural concerns; they can also affect operational efficiency and safety. For instance, if a foundation begins to settle unevenly or experiences cracking due to soil movement or water infiltration, it can lead to misalignment of critical equipment such as turbines and generators.

This misalignment can result in increased wear and tear, higher maintenance costs, and even unplanned outages. Therefore, regular assessments of foundation stability are essential to preemptively identify issues before they escalate into more significant problems.

Elion’s Approach to Structural Evaluation

Elion employs a systematic and comprehensive approach to structural evaluation that encompasses several key phases. Initially, the process begins with a detailed site assessment where engineers gather data on existing conditions. This includes reviewing historical records, conducting visual inspections, and utilizing non-destructive testing methods to evaluate material properties without causing damage.

By collecting this baseline data, Elion can establish a clear understanding of the current state of the structure. Following the initial assessment, Elion utilizes advanced modeling techniques to simulate various load scenarios that the structure may encounter throughout its operational life. This predictive analysis allows engineers to identify potential failure points and assess how different factors—such as seismic activity or extreme weather conditions—could impact foundation stability.

The use of software tools that incorporate finite element analysis enables Elion to visualize stress distributions within the structure, providing invaluable insights into areas that may require reinforcement or remediation.

Challenges Faced During the Evaluation Process

The evaluation process is not without its challenges, particularly when dealing with large-scale facilities like power plants. One significant hurdle is access to certain areas of the structure that may be difficult to reach due to operational constraints or safety regulations. For instance, heavy machinery may obstruct access points, or ongoing operations may limit the time available for thorough inspections.

Elion’s team must navigate these logistical challenges while ensuring that evaluations are conducted safely and effectively. Another challenge lies in the variability of geological conditions surrounding the power plant. Chhattisgarh’s diverse soil types can exhibit different behaviors under load, complicating assessments of foundation stability.

For example, clay soils may expand or contract with moisture changes, while sandy soils may shift under heavy loads. To address these complexities, Elion often collaborates with geotechnical experts who provide insights into soil behavior and recommend appropriate foundation designs tailored to local conditions.

Results and Findings of the Structural Evaluation

Photo Structural Evaluation

The results of Elion’s structural evaluation at the Chhattisgarh power plant revealed several critical insights regarding foundation stability. Through meticulous analysis and testing, engineers identified areas where soil compaction had decreased over time, leading to potential settlement issues. Additionally, some sections of the foundation exhibited minor cracking that could escalate if not addressed promptly.

These findings underscored the importance of ongoing monitoring and maintenance to ensure long-term stability. Furthermore, Elion’s evaluation highlighted the effectiveness of existing reinforcement measures but also pointed out areas where additional support could enhance overall structural integrity. For instance, certain load-bearing columns were found to be under stress due to shifting soil conditions, prompting recommendations for supplementary bracing or underpinning techniques.

The comprehensive nature of these findings provided stakeholders with a clear roadmap for necessary interventions and prioritized actions based on risk assessment.
